I don’t know about you but I love Khaki and Denim.  I love it even more when there is a little leopard thrown in.  Madewell and J Crew are my go to sources for casual wear.  Their clothes seem to consistently fit me properly.  If I want something interesting or special I head to Artful Home.  I will be posting about their exciting fall collection next month; you are going to love their new collection.
Here on the Central Coast we don’t really have a fall. I really miss that time of year. August, September, and October are our nicest months.  It does cool off in the evenings as the days get shorter so a jacket is sometimes in order. I love this Ruffle Chino Jacket  from J Crew.  It can be worn year round in our climate.  Add my favorite Long Sleeve Shine Crew Tee, from Michael Stars, that is just a little more polished looking than your average tee (a little pricier but much longer wearing) .  Pair them with (the splurge in this group) the Dl1961 Margaux Instasculpt Ankle Skinny Jeans, the inexpensive leopard print scarf from Sole Society, the BP Demi Slide (on sale), and Kate Spade’s Crossbody Bag.

This Prospect Jacket from Madewell is on my wish list (it’s on sale as well). It is the perfect weight and color to wear with a pair of jeans or black pants.  I tried it on and love the cut. It is way more flattering on than it appears.  It can be cinched in at the waist for a more flattering fit if you prefer. I love these leopard slides from BP (they are on sale too).  I have foot issues and I tried these on in the store and I think they might work as well.  Ever since I saw the chic Brenda Kinsel in a pair like these wide leg crop jeans from Madewell, I have been tempted to pull the trigger. Madewell always has great bags at competitive prices.  I am trying to learn to carry a smaller bag.  I really love this small transport crossbody bag from Madewell but if you are like me you may still need the large crossbody bag. I own this silk bandana (it is on final sale better grab it) from Madewell and love it.  The Always Chambray Shirt from J Crew is a favorite in my closet, and who doesn’t need a new pair of  tortoise shades?
